It can be hard to translate regular season success to the playoffs, but Saint James had no problem doing just that on Monday. Their pitchers stepped up to hand the Montgomery Academy Eagles a 15-0 shutout. Saint James might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team's won 18 games by six runs or more this season.
Peyton Middleton looked comfortable as she pitched an inning while giving up no earned runs or hits. She has been nothing but reliable on the mound: she hasn't given up more than two walks in six consecutive pitching appearances.
At the plate, Saint James got a massive performance out of Arden Green, who went 2-for-2 with three RBI, a triple, and a run. The team also got some help courtesy of Sydney Johnston, who scored three runs and stole two bases while going 1-for-2.
The victory was the sixth in a row for Saint James, bringing their record for this year to 31-2. As for Montgomery Academy,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 1-14.
Saint James is on the road again on Monday to play Alabama Christian Academy at 4:00 p.m. Saint James is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 8.7 runs per game this season. Montgomery Academy does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
